2017-09-20 10 views
2

IdentityServer 4に実装されたIDPがあります。私のWebアプリケーションクライアント(MVC 5で実装されています)はIDPで認証しますが、今は要求からアクセストークンを取得する必要があります。 ネットコアにそうようなMicrosoft.AspNetCore.Authentication.AuthenticationTokenExtensions使用することを実行する方法:私は私の.NET Mvc5 Webアプリケーションのクライアントで同じことを行うことができるようにしたいと思いますが、私はいずれかを見つけることができませんowinとMvcを使用してhttpcontextからアクセストークンを取得する方法5

HttpContext.Authentication.GetTokenAsync("acccess_token") 

を類似の実装を持つnugetパッケージまたは名前空間。 MVC5ではこれを行うことができ、.netコアではできないことが重要です。誰もがこれに前に出会った?

私はあなたがこのコードを使用してトークンを取得することができ、あなたのコントローラでOpenIdConnect

答えて

1

を使用していることを言及することも価値がPS-:

var token = ActionContext.Request.Headers.Authorization.Parameter; 
関連する問題